Renault continues protests against Racing Point after F1 British GP

After similar protests following the Styrian and Hungarian Grand Prix, Renault has protested against the Silverstone-based outfit for the third race in a row at the British Grand Prix. Lance Stroll was the only Racing Point driver to take the chequered flag at Silverstone after Nico Hulkenberg’s RP20 failed to take the start, meaning the protest is only related to the Canadian’s car on this occasion. Stroll finished the British Grand Prix in ninth place, behind both Renault cars as Daniel Ricciardo took fourth...
